A member asked:

I had an mri done on my lumbar on december 28th. i received an email this morning from my doctor stating that i have l5 s1 stenosis.?

Spinal stenosis is a: Narrowing of the spinal canal (in the lower lumbar region in your case) that can compress the spinal cord, cause pain, or compromise function, depending on severity.
